Job Description
We are seeking a visionary 2D Graphics Engineer to join our elite team at Kinetic Digital. As a leader in interactive media, we are building the next generation of immersive web experiences that push the boundaries of what is possible in the browser. You will be responsible for architecting high-performance rendering engines, optimizing visual fidelity, and bridging the gap between artistic design and technical implementation.
In this role, you will collaborate closely with UI/UX designers and 3D artists to transform static concepts into fluid, interactive masterpieces. If you have a passion for pixel-perfect animation and a deep understanding of computer graphics mathematics, we want to hear from you.
Responsibilities
- Architect and maintain high-performance 2D rendering engines using WebGL and the HTML5 Canvas API.
- Optimize graphics pipelines to achieve 60+ FPS on a wide range of devices and network conditions.
- Implement advanced particle systems, physics simulations, and procedural animations.
- Collaborate with cross-functional teams to translate creative briefs into technical specifications.
- Debug complex rendering issues and implement shader programs for custom visual effects.
- Stay up-to-date with the latest browser technologies and graphics standards.
Qualifications
- Bachelor’s degree in Computer Science, Mathematics, or a related technical field.
- 5+ years of professional experience in graphics programming or 2D animation development.
- Expert proficiency in JavaScript, WebGL, and modern CSS/HTML5.
- Strong understanding of linear algebra, vectors, and matrix transformations.
- Experience with game engines (Unity or Unreal) is a plus.
- Demonstrated ability to write clean, efficient, and well-documented code.